Foley Partner Lawrence Vernaglia, a member of the Health Care Industry Team, will be speaking at this year’s AHLA Annual Meeting in Boston. Mr. Vernaglia will be presenting with Andrew Ruskin, a partner at Morgan Lewis, on Monday, June 24th, at 3:15 p.m. Their presentation is titled, “Strategic Planning for Physician Practice Acquisitions in the Post-Site-Neutrality Payment Era,” and their presentation will cover the following:
- The market for physician practice acquisition
- A breakdown of all of the Outpatient Fee Schedule changes over the past two years relevant to physician practice acquisitions, and the implications of the litigation relating thereto
- Update on the status of accountable care organizations (ACOs)
- Implications of the shifting business and regulatory environment on the value of different structures of physician practice acquisitions
- Implications for participation in the 340B Drug Purchasing Program
The presentation will also be repeated at 10:45 a.m. on Wednesday, June 26th.
